The barrel of failure in our lives

When we look down at failure, we do whatever it takes, something, anything, to get moving, to start an upward climb to the point of survival. And, once we get to that point where our head is above the waters, we get content. We than start to head back down again. As we get closer to the failure line that we see coming, we once again do whatever it takes to turn this route around and start heading back up to survival. And the cycle continues….

That’s what I have done and what many other people do, living their entire life oscillating between failure and survival, sometimes striving towards success, may be even reaching there and then turning back and heading downwards again.

We do this with our finances, relationships, health and in our lives as a whole. We sabotage ourselves for all kinds of reasons. We blame the past, the present, the circumstances, the environment, we’re mean to ourselves and for some reason we believe we don’t deserve success. but what we don’t realize is that when we are at the bottom, the failure path, we find a way, something, anything, to get moving towards survival, then our comforts begin and that is where we stop progressing. This is the only reason why our lives follow this roller coaster, it’s that simple. As soon as we get away from failure and up past the line of survival, we quit doing the things that got us there. And you know what that means, it means you know already how to do everything it takes to make you an outrageous success. And all you need to do is it keep going, but we don’t. 99.9 percent of the people do the same.

There is a profound success secret hidden within this roller coaster, if we would only keep doing the things that got us from failure up to survival in the first place. So, what exactly are those things? What are the actions that move us upwards from failure to survival and then the actions that drive us down? The answer is ‘Simple’’……

The things that take us out of failure and up towards survival and success is ‘’Simple’’, so simple that it is so easy to overlook. It’s easy to overlook them because when you look at them, they are so insignificant. They are not big things that take up huge effort, nothing dramatic. But mostly just little things you do every day that no one actually notices. They are things that are so simple to do, that successful people actually do them, while unsuccessful people look at them and don’t take action.

Let’s get some examples to understand what I mean, finances – taking a percentage out of your paycheck and keeping it in your savings so compounding it will grow. Following a consistent exercise plan to keep fit, grow your body without skipping or taking short cuts, reading 10 pages of a book daily to improve your language skills, or to give you inspirations/motivation, take a moment to tall someone how much you appreciate them. These are little simple things, which when compounded yield big results.

In business, it is the same, once you develop your business plan and have a strategy, you need to continuously monitor it, successful business, daily review their performance with the previous day.

Things that leaders do every day daily, clarifying and visualizing their goals ensuring they are always on the right path. Review their incomes and look into their marketing plans. Make time to grow themselves, invest in their growth. Network with others in their field, expand their circle of influence. Act as leaders to their teams, subordinates, accepting accountability for actions, tasks and goals they are committed to.

Let us all try to live simple but consistent in what we do.....and that will bring us success and happiness.
